如果没有代表,活动是否有效? [英] Shall event works without delegates?
本文介绍了如果没有代表,活动是否有效?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!
问题描述
我知道事件在底部使用委托。
但是事件是否可以在没有代表的情况下工作?
I know events uses delegates in bottom.
But shall event works without delegates?
推荐答案
基本上没有。
代表基本上是对函数的引用,如果没有这样的机制,事件就无法运行,我们将回到旧的Windows方式手动处理消息循环。
有很多关于事件如何工作的文章,但这里有一个很好的描述: http://www.ikriv.com/dev/dotnet/delegates.html [ ^ ]和 C#中的事件和事件处理 [ ^ ]也是有帮助的(如果相当陈旧)。
Basically, no.
Delegates are basically references to functions, and without some mechanism like that, events could not function, and we would be back to the older Windows way of manually processing a message loop.
There is a lot written about how events work, but there is a good description here: http://www.ikriv.com/dev/dotnet/delegates.html[^] and Events and event handling in C#[^] is helpfull (if rather old) as well.
这篇关于如果没有代表,活动是否有效?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!
查看全文